Loading

SP_82A1152

  • Caption: during the 2021 Safari Sevens at Nyayo National Stadium on October 31, 2021.Photo/Mohammed Amin/www.Sports-pot.com
  • Credit: Mohammed Amin
  • Taken: 31 October, 2021
Need Help?